Understanding Shift Swapping in the Restaurant Industry

Shift swapping in restaurants refers to the practice where employees trade their scheduled shifts with coworkers, allowing for greater flexibility while ensuring all positions remain covered. In Murrieta’s competitive dining scene, this practice has become increasingly important for retention and operational stability. Understanding the core components of effective shift swapping systems is essential for restaurant owners looking to implement this practice successfully.

  • Direct Exchange: The most common form of shift swapping where one employee directly trades their shift with another qualified colleague who can perform the same role.
  • Shift Marketplace: A system where employees can post shifts they need covered, allowing interested and qualified coworkers to pick them up, often facilitated through digital platforms.
  • Partial Shifts: Some restaurants allow for splitting shifts between multiple employees when a full shift cannot be covered by a single worker.
  • Manager-Approved Swaps: A process requiring management verification to ensure qualifications match and labor regulations are maintained before approving the swap.
  • Self-Service Options: Modern scheduling systems that empower employees to initiate and complete shift swaps with minimal manager intervention while maintaining business rules.

        Common Challenges in Restaurant Shift Swapping

        Despite its benefits, implementing shift swapping in Murrieta restaurants comes with several challenges that owners and managers must address. Understanding these potential pitfalls is essential for developing a system that works efficiently without creating additional problems or disruptions to service quality.

        • Skill Mismatches: Ensuring the employee taking over a shift has the necessary skills and certifications for the position, particularly for specialized roles like bartending or kitchen management.
        • Communication Breakdowns: Without proper communication tools, shift swap arrangements may not be properly documented or communicated to management, leading to confusion and potential no-shows.
        • Overtime Complications: Unmonitored shift swapping can inadvertently result in overtime situations when employees pick up too many additional shifts, increasing labor costs unexpectedly.
        • Favoritism Concerns: Without clear policies, shift swapping may create perceptions of favoritism if certain employees seem to get preferential treatment in the approval process.
        • Labor Law Compliance: California has specific labor regulations that Murrieta restaurants must follow, including break requirements and minor labor laws, which can be complicated by shift swaps.

          Setting Up an Effective Shift Swapping System

          Establishing a well-designed shift swapping system is crucial for Murrieta restaurants looking to balance flexibility with operational stability. A thoughtful implementation requires clear policies, appropriate tools, and ongoing monitoring to ensure the system achieves its intended benefits without creating unintended consequences.

          • Clear Written Policy: Develop comprehensive guidelines outlining eligibility, request procedures, approval processes, and deadlines for shift swaps that all staff understand and can easily reference.
          • Digital Solutions: Implement employee scheduling software that facilitates shift swapping while enforcing business rules automatically, reducing manual oversight needs.
          • Qualification Matching: Create a system that automatically verifies whether employees have the right skills, certifications, and training to cover specific positions before approving swaps.
          • Time Parameters: Establish reasonable timeframes for requesting and approving shift swaps (e.g., minimum 24-48 hours notice) to maintain operational planning ability.
          • Manager Oversight: Design appropriate levels of managerial review that provide necessary oversight without creating bottlenecks in the approval process.

                Legal and Compliance Considerations in Murrieta

                Restaurant owners in Murrieta must navigate California’s robust labor regulations when implementing shift swapping policies. Understanding these legal requirements is essential to avoid costly penalties and ensure compliance while maintaining scheduling flexibility.

                • California Meal and Rest Break Requirements: Ensure shift swaps don’t result in employees working shifts that violate California’s mandatory meal and rest break provisions, which are strictly enforced.
                • Overtime Regulations: California’s overtime rules apply after 8 hours in a day and 40 hours in a week, so shift swaps must be monitored to prevent unintended overtime costs and compliance issues.
                • Minor Work Restrictions: For restaurants employing workers under 18, shift swaps must continue to comply with California’s restrictions on minor work hours, particularly for school nights.
                • Reporting Time Pay: California law requires employers to pay employees who report to work but are sent home early, so shift swap miscommunications could trigger these requirements.
                • Record-Keeping Requirements: Maintain detailed documentation of original schedules and all approved swaps to demonstrate compliance with labor laws during potential audits.
                • While Murrieta itself doesn’t have specific local predictive scheduling laws like some California cities, state-level regulations still apply. Restaurant owners should consider consulting with labor law specialists when developing shift swap policies to ensure they’re designed with full compliance in mind, particularly as California’s labor laws continue to evolve.

                  Measuring the Impact of Shift Swapping

                  To ensure shift swapping practices are truly beneficial for your Murrieta restaurant, it’s important to track key metrics that measure both operational impact and employee satisfaction. Data-driven analysis helps restaurant owners refine their approach and quantify the return on investment from implementing formal shift swapping systems.

                  • Schedule Adherence Rate: Track how often shifts are worked as originally scheduled versus swapped to identify patterns and potential scheduling improvements.
                  • Manager Time Savings: Measure the reduction in administrative hours spent handling scheduling changes after implementing a structured shift swap system.
                  • Employee Satisfaction Scores: Conduct regular surveys to gauge how shift flexibility impacts overall employee satisfaction and workplace morale.
                  • Labor Cost Fluctuations: Monitor how shift swapping affects overall labor costs, including potential reductions in overtime or last-minute staffing premiums.
                  • Customer Experience Metrics: Correlate shift swap data with customer satisfaction scores to ensure service quality remains consistent regardless of schedule changes.
                  • Restaurants using tracking metrics for their shift swap programs report finding valuable operational insights beyond just scheduling efficiency. For example, patterns in shift swap requests often reveal underlying scheduling issues that can be addressed proactively. By analyzing which shifts are most frequently swapped, Murrieta restaurant managers can adjust base schedules to better align with employee preferences while still meeting business needs.

                    1. How can restaurant owners in Murrieta ensure fair shift swapping policies?

                    Restaurant owners can ensure fairness by establishing clear, written policies that apply equally to all employees. These should include specific criteria for approving swaps, consistent documentation requirements, and transparent communication about the process. Using automated systems that apply rules consistently helps prevent perceptions of favoritism. Regular review of swap patterns can identify if certain employees are being disadvantaged. Additionally, creating a system where shift availability is visible to all qualified staff—not just select individuals—promotes equal opportunity. Consider implementing digital marketplaces where all available shifts can be viewed and requested by eligible employees.

                    2. What are the legal requirements for shift swapping in Murrieta, California?

                    In Murrieta, California, shift swapping must comply with state labor laws including overtime regulations (after 8 hours daily or 40 hours weekly), mandatory meal and rest breaks, and minor work restrictions for employees under 18. While Murrieta doesn’t have specific local predictive scheduling laws, restaurants must maintain accurate records of all worked shifts, including swaps, to demonstrate compliance with wage and hour laws. Employers remain responsible for ensuring all labor laws are followed, even when employees trade shifts. This includes maintaining appropriate staffing ratios for serving alcohol if applicable. Restaurants should also ensure their shift swapping policies don’t inadvertently discriminate against protected classes, which could violate California’s robust anti-discrimination laws.

                    4. What metrics should I track to measure shift swapping effectiveness in my restaurant?

                    To measure the effectiveness of your shift swapping system, track both operational and employee-centered metrics. Key operational indicators include the percentage of shifts that get swapped (to identify potential scheduling issues), time from swap request to resolution, coverage success rate for swapped shifts, and impact on labor costs including overtime. From the employee perspective, monitor satisfaction through surveys specifically addressing scheduling flexibility, track retention rates before and after implementing formal swap systems, and measure participation rates across different departments or positions. Additionally, correlate customer satisfaction and service quality metrics during periods with high swap activity to ensure there’s no negative impact.                     5. How do I handle disputes related to shift swaps in my Murrieta restaurant?

                    Handle shift swap disputes by first establishing a clear escalation process in your written policy. When conflicts arise, begin with direct conversation with involved parties to understand the specific issue. Refer to documented evidence from your scheduling system to clarify what was agreed upon. Implement a fair review process where a neutral manager not directly involved can assess the situation. For recurring issues, consider revising policies or providing additional training on the shift swap process. Using conflict resolution techniques specific to scheduling can help address underlying issues. Document all disputes and resolutions for future reference, and periodically review these incidents to identify potential improvements to your overall swap system. Remember that California employment laws provide certain protections, so consult with HR or legal advisors for persistent or complex disputes.
